Maisto Diecast Icons 2009 Corvette C06

I only had small scale Corvettes and always thought that they were just another muscle car. When this larger scale model came out at a wholesale store, I took a chance of getting one in addition to a couple of cars in the same series. Good thing I did it because I got to appreciate the beauty of Corvettes with this C06.

The model is 1:24 scale and has more details than the smaller diecast cars such as side mirrors, spoked rims, and plastic on the metal body. The interior is easy to see because of the opening doors. The paint designs are the large paint stripe in the center over the yellow body and the Corvette logos. The interior paint designs are extremely minimal and applied on the steering wheel. There is a sticker attached on the dashboard console behind the steering wheel, a regular feature of Maisto models.

I think this Icons series is a level below the Special Edition series because it lacks a fourth opening feature and the wheels do not turn. I remember Maisto making models at this scale that has the wheel turning feature, but those were in the 90's. They most likely omitted this feature to lower costs.

The Corvette looks good in this basic Icons series in its signature racer yellow body appearance.

Matchbox Porsche 911

The Porsche 911 Turbo is the third car in the 5-pack. It comes in red, shiny body paint with some paint designs in the right places. This is a cool car because it is very detailed for a Matchbox model. It has wipers, side mirrors, same sized wheels, and detailed interior. The model is an old casting, based on the date. I checked the date and it says 2001 with the old Matchbox logo during that year. I noticed that the 911 is a wider model compared to the present releases. It may be the standard size during those years that allowed the designers to add more details than usual. Hot Wheels Aisle Driver

The Aisle Driver is a fantasy model of a racing pushcart. I don't think this pushcart can hold any grocery item with its appearance. The pushcart has an open front and back basket that will certainly make grocery items drop the floor as it moves. This idea most likely came from role-playing a pushcart as a race car that some people do when they do groceries. The pushcart uses the Hot Wheels default wheels setup with the large wheels at the back and regular wheels at the front. The metal part is dedicated to the basket. The basket has some mesh patterns and a couple of pegs in the middle that is most likely can be used by Lego minifigures. The plastic base has a bumper in the front and footstep at the back. The yellow driver figure does not move but can be detached from the handlebar and attached to the other parts of the basket. The figure can stand on its own and is similar to a Megabloks figure.
